What companies run services between Oberlin, OH, USA and Buffalo, NY, USA?

Greyhound USA operates a bus from Cleveland Bus Station to Buffalo twice daily. Tickets cost $30–65 and the journey takes 3h 30m. Alternatively, Amtrak operates a train from Elyria Station to Buffalo Depew Station twice daily. Tickets cost $55–130 and the journey takes 3h 51m.
